Output 137d96b1d8dd601eae73aec66040606b666de3d4b73b2cfd3596a73a28513857:0

value
3713300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5104062e7ed57dff0176baa42e72b48d59f16f6d OP_EQUAL
address
395PUgfRDGXgxMCVUdUocjrsns5LoXjxVk
transaction
137d96b1d8dd601eae73aec66040606b666de3d4b73b2cfd3596a73a28513857
confirmations
117672
spent
true